Celebrating 55 Years of Community. Rebuilding for the Future.
Since 1970, the Flamingo Heights Community Center has been the heart of our High Desert neighborhood. For decades, we’ve come together here—to share meals, host events, lend a hand during emergencies, and celebrate the things that make life in Flamingo Heights so unique.
Now, we’re back and better than ever. After a quiet spell, we’re rolling up our sleeves, dusting off the furniture, and reimagining what this space can become. Whether you’ve lived here for generations, just unpacked your boxes, call the area home, or simply feel a connection to this community—FHCC belongs to you.

FHCC is led by a dedicated group of community members who volunteer their time, skills, and passion to support the revitalization of Flamingo Heights and its community center.
This committed board includes Justin Merino, Debbie Melford, Dustin Tuttle, Nick Brown, Roxanna Shamay, Eleanor Whitney, and Digna Irizarry-Cassens.
Together, they bring a diverse range of experiences and a shared commitment to building a stronger, more connected community for all who call Flamingo Heights home.
